A resolution or order calling an election on a proposed formation or change of organization shall:
(1) Provide for giving notice of the special election or elections upon the question.
(2) Designate each district or other territory within which the election or elections are to be held.
(3) Fix a date for the election, which date shall be the same for each election when an election is called upon the same question within more than one territory or district.
(4) State the substance of the question or questions to be submitted to the electors.
(5) Specify any terms and conditions provided for in the formation or change of organization.
(6) Contain such other matters as may be necessary to call, provide for and give notice of the election or elections and to provide for the conduct thereof and the canvass of the returns thereupon.
